Background on John Bolton

John Bolton served as National Security Advisor under President Donald Trump from April 2018 until September 2019. Known for his hawkish foreign policy stance, Bolton has been a controversial figure in American politics. His resignation stemmed from policy disagreements with President Trump, and since then, Bolton has remained vocal on issues related to national security and foreign relations.

Contextualizing the Indictment: A Historical Perspective

The legal proceedings against Bolton can be understood better when viewed in the context of previous high-profile cases involving national security. History shows that former officials, regardless of party affiliation, have faced scrutiny for mishandling classified information.

Previous Cases

  • Hillary Clinton: The investigation into Clinton’s use of a private email server while serving as Secretary of State sparked intense debate over national security standards.

  • David Petraeus: The former CIA Director faced legal consequences for disclosing classified information to a biographer, demonstrating that high-ranking officials are not immune to prosecution.
